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ups broccoli florets
- 1 can (15 oz) chickpeas, drained and rinsed
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 small onion, sliced
- 2 tbsp soy sauce
- 1 tbsp honey
- 1 tsp sesame oil
- 1/2 tsp red pepper flakes
- 1 tbsp sesame seeds (for garnish)
- 2 green onions, chopped (for garnish)
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 2 cups cooked white rice (for serving
Instructions
-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add garlic and onion, sautéing until fragrant, about 2 minutes.
- Add broccoli florets and chickpeas to the skillet, stirring to coat them in the garlic mixture. Cook for 5 minutes.
- In a small bowl, whisk together soy sauce, honey, sesame oil, and red pepper flakes. Pour the sauce over the broccoli and chickpeas.
- Stir well and cook for another 3-5 minutes until the broccoli is tender and the sauce thickens slightly.
- Serve over cooked white rice, garnished with sesame seeds and green onions.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
Nutrition
- Serving Size: ¼ of the stir fry with ½ cup rice
- Calories: 320 kcal
- Sugar: 8 g
- Sodium: 680 mg
- Fat: 11 g
- Saturated Fat: 1.5 g
- Unsaturated Fat: 9 g
- Trans Fat: 0 g
- Carbohydrates: 46 g
- Fiber: 7 g
- Protein: 10 g
- Cholesterol: 0 mg
